As part of our “Owl Workshop Series”, NCLT invites your to an Owl Prowl Night Hike at Crocker Conservation Area, Friday, October 22, 6:00pm-8:30pm.

Engage your senses of sight and sound as we explore our trails while the full moon begins to rise and nocturnal creatures become active. We will walk quietly, avoid using our flashlights, and try to call in a barred owl! To preserve night vision, we will have several red light night flashlights available but feel free to bring your own or make one by securing a red cloth over your flashlight (use a rubber band).
